Yesterday was the last competition of the season for one of my daughters 2 cheer teams, so off we went to Newcastle for one last time on the mat in 2017/18.

The journey there showed me just how much my cheerleader has grown up this season, watching her apply her own makeup as I drove! We had a really fun day, and as always I barely saw her from the second we walked in, as she is too busy off with her cheer family! She is 12, and the youngest member of this team, but that makes no difference at all to the adult members, she is one of them.


The best experience of the day was watching the IOC5 team from our program perform. There are a couple of members of that team who are really close to my heart, and as a team they have had a tough season. Not yesterday......

They set, the music started, opening tumbles hit and I swear the air literally turned electric! Stunt after stunt went up and bang hit, hit, hit! There was sass, stunting and tumbling all at 10 on the richter scale! This team deserved this, so much and I felt privileged to be witnessing it. They hit zero and placed 2nd, best placing of the season, watching them realise they had achieved what they set out to do was amazing.
